THORWallet Announces Upcoming Launch of Its Next-Generation Card Program
By:BeInCrypto
THORWallet is preparing to launch their own card program designed to offer greater flexibility, transparency, and global accessibility for crypto users. The upcoming THORWallet Card represents a significant evolution of the platforms card infrastructure, enabling faster activation, simplified and free top-ups, and expanded card functionality. The new program introduces both physical and virtual cards with instant activation from day one. All cards are USD-denominated and support fee-free top-ups using USDC, with no additional top-up charges applied. A Pro card tier will also be available, offering zero FX markup, zero ATM markup, higher spending limits, and a cashback mechanism linked to TITN staking. This tier is designed for users seeking a streamlined and cost-efficient payment experience. The updated card infrastructure allows for future expansion, including additional card denominations such as EUR or CHF, as well as premium features like airport lounge access, travel insurance, and upgraded card materials. The Next-Gen THORWallet Card will be available in 174 countries worldwide, including the United States, and will operate alongside the existing Swiss IBAN card program, complementing current payment solutions. The new card program aims to bridge decentralized finance with traditional payment systems, offering users a flexible and scalable crypto-to-card experience.
